I am trying to build Kamailio v3.0.0 RC2 on Solaris 10 (note: *not* OpenSolaris), but I have been faced with a couple issues I hope you
can
help me with.
The first issue has to do with GNU as (/usr/sfw/bin/gas), there
appears
to be a check somewhere for what I assume to be the version number of the GNU assembler. When the make is running "/usr/sfw/bin/gas -V" it just hangs at this point with the following output from make: [..] If you need any further information please dont hesitate to ask, any help in resolving the issue would be greatly appreciated.
Hello Bruce,
it seems that Andrei did a few solaris specific fixes recently, this one 0f7ec046ce88202 - makefile: fix assembler detection on solaris
Assembler test waited forever for input (missing /dev/null input redirection for as -V).
looks at it fits to your problem. This is probably not yet included in the -rc2 version, perhaps you can try the sr_3.0 branch until it a new -rc has been releases.
